Abstract
The utility model discloses a feeding device for a printing machine, which relates to the technical field of feeding of the printing machine and comprises a workbench, a limiting mechanism, a dust removing mechanism and a transmission mechanism, wherein the limiting mechanism comprises a pair of fixing plates fixedly arranged on the upper wall surface of the workbench, a pair of electric telescopic rods are arranged on the fixing plates, sliding blocks are fixedly arranged at the telescopic ends of the electric telescopic rods, limiting wheels are rotatably arranged under the sliding blocks, and a pair of sliding grooves are arranged on the workbench surface and are in sliding connection with the sliding blocks. The paper motion can make the spacing wheel rotate, can not lead to the fact the curling to the paper edge, has avoided the waste to the paper, can realize simultaneously the effect of removing dust and the removal impurity to the paper before getting into the printing machine, has avoided because there is the problem that the dust makes printing effect not ideal on the paper.

Background
A printer is a machine that prints text and images. Modern printers typically consist of mechanisms for loading, inking, stamping, paper feeding, and the like. The working principle of the device is as follows: the method is characterized in that a printing plate is made of characters and images to be printed, the printing plate is arranged on a printer, then ink is coated on the places with the characters and the images on the printing plate by a manual or printing machine, and then the printing plate is directly or indirectly transferred onto paper or other printing stock (such as textile, metal plate, plastic, leather, wood plate, glass and ceramics), so that the printed matter which is the same as the printing plate is reproduced, for example, a spacing feeding material for a half-rotary printing machine with the publication number of CN215325975u comprises a base and support columns which are respectively fixed at one end of the base, the automatic feeding of the printing machine is realized, the labor cost is saved for the equipment, but the following problem 1 still exists. 2. The equipment in this comparison document does not set up dust removal mechanism, often can remain impurity such as a lot of dust piece on printing stock such as paper or fabrics, and these impurity can not clear up effectively and can make the characters and the pattern of printing after the paper gets into the printing machine unclear, leads to wasting a large amount of paper resources.

The following components are of the present case:
the detailed connection means are known in the art, and the following mainly describes the working principle and process, and the specific work is as follows.
Examples: according to the specification and the drawing, firstly, paper to be printed passes through a limiting mechanism, a dust removing mechanism, a transmission mechanism and a feeding hole, a pair of electric telescopic rods are started, telescopic ends of the electric telescopic rods push sliding blocks to move on sliding grooves in opposite directions until the paper touches a notch of a limiting wheel, then the electric telescopic rods are closed, at the moment, a motor is opened, a driving end of the motor rotates to drive a covered pressing roller to rotate, three rollers below the covered pressing roller are pressed downwards under the stress of springs, the covered pressing roller enables the paper to move towards a printing machine along the rotating direction of the rollers through friction force, when the paper passes through the dust removing mechanism, a rubber wheel and a driven wheel below the paper rotate along with the movement of the paper, dust, sweeps and other impurities on the paper are cleaned, a pair of clamping blocks are opened periodically, the positioning wheels are turned over to sequentially use the remaining three rubber wheels, after the rubber roller is used up, the whole positioning wheels are replaced, the positioning blocks are placed in the clamping blocks, and the clamping blocks are closed, and a knob is screwed to enable the movable rod to rotate to fix the clamping blocks.
